Details
A vulnerability classified as problematic was found in LimeSurvey 2.05+ (Survey Software). Affected by this vulnerability is the function autoEscape of the file common_helper.php. The manipulation of the argument loadname with an unknown input leads to a incomplete blacklist vulnerability. The CWE definition for the vulnerability is CWE-184. The product implements a protection mechanism that relies on a list of inputs (or properties of inputs) that are not allowed by policy or otherwise require other action to neutralize before additional processing takes place, but the list is incomplete, leading to resultant weaknesses. As an impact it is known to affect integrity. The summary by CVE is:
Incomplete blacklist vulnerability in the autoEscape function in common_helper.php in LimeSurvey 2.05+ Build 140618 allows remote attackers to conduct cross-site scripting (XSS) attacks via the GBK charset in the loadname parameter to index.php, related to the survey resume.
The weakness was disclosed 07/21/2014 (Website). The advisory is shared at github.com. This vulnerability is known as CVE-2014-5018 since 07/21/2014. The attack can be launched remotely. The exploitation doesn't need any form of authentication. It demands that the victim is doing some kind of user interaction. Technical details are known, but no exploit is available. MITRE ATT&CK project uses the attack technique T1562.006 for this issue.
